NTBG Seed Bank and Laboratory Manager, Dustin Wolkis, cataloging Ohia Lehua seeds. Rapid Ohia Death (ROD) affects thousands of acres of native forests across Hawaii. NTBG's Seed Bank and Laboratory conducts research and tracks data to support ohia lehua restoration efforts statewide and currently has over 8 million Metrosideros polymorpha seeds in storage.
